Arturo Magidin 《Algebra Universalis》2002,48(2):133-143
We determine the dominion (in the sense of Isbell) of a subgroup H of a finite nonabelian simple group S in Var(S). We also obtain necessary and suficient conditions for H to be epimorphically embedded in S, and derive several examples, which generalize an example of B. H. Neumann. Finally, we extend the results to a variety generated
by a family of finite nonabelian simple groups.

Arturo Quirantes 《Journal of Quantitative Spectroscopy & Radiative Transfer》2005,92(3):373-381
A computer code is described for the calculation of light-scattering properties of randomly oriented, axially symmetric coated particles, in the framework of the T-matrix theory. The underlying mathematical background is outlined briefly and convergence procedures are discussed. After outlining the input-output interaction between user and code, benchmark results are presented for two distinct shapes: coated, centered spheroids and offset coated spheres. 相似文献

David Y. Song Arturo A. Pizano Patrick G. Holder JoAnne Stubbe Daniel G. Nocera 《Chemical science》2015,6(8):4519-4524
Proton-coupled electron transfer (PCET) is a fundamental mechanism important in a wide range of biological processes including the universal reaction catalysed by ribonucleotide reductases (RNRs) in making de novo, the building blocks required for DNA replication and repair. These enzymes catalyse the conversion of nucleoside diphosphates (NDPs) to deoxynucleoside diphosphates (dNDPs). In the class Ia RNRs, NDP reduction involves a tyrosyl radical mediated oxidation occurring over 35 Å across the interface of the two required subunits (β2 and α2) involving multiple PCET steps and the conserved tyrosine triad [Y356(β2)–Y731(α2)–Y730(α2)]. We report the synthesis of an active photochemical RNR (photoRNR) complex in which a Re(i)-tricarbonyl phenanthroline ([Re]) photooxidant is attached site-specifically to the Cys in the Y356C-(β2) subunit and an ionizable, 2,3,5-trifluorotyrosine (2,3,5-F3Y) is incorporated in place of Y731 in α2. This intersubunit PCET pathway is investigated by ns laser spectroscopy on [Re356]-β2:2,3,5-F3Y731-α2 in the presence of substrate, CDP, and effector, ATP. This experiment has allowed analysis of the photoinjection of a radical into α2 from β2 in the absence of the interfacial Y356 residue. The system is competent for light-dependent substrate turnover. Time-resolved emission experiments reveal an intimate dependence of the rate of radical injection on the protonation state at position Y731(α2), which in turn highlights the importance of a well-coordinated proton exit channel involving the key residues, Y356 and Y731, at the subunit interface. 相似文献

Arturo Fernández Arias 《Complex Analysis and Operator Theory》2017,11(8):1653-1668
The study of meromorphic functions without multiple values in the plane started by F. Nevanlinna is extended to meromorphic functions in the punctured plane \({\mathbb {C}}^{{*}}.\) It is a classical result that a meromorphic function \(f\left( z\right) \) can be obtained as quotient of solutions of the second order differential equation \(u^{{\prime \prime }}+\left\{ f\left( z\right) ,z\right\} u=0,\) where \(\left\{ f\left( z\right) ,z\right\} \) is the Schwarzian derivative of \(f\left( z\right) \). In our hypothesis of meromorphic functions of finite order without multiple values in the puntured plane, the Schwarzian derivative \(\left\{ f\left( z\right) , z\right\} \) turns out to be a rational function with only possible poles at 0 and \(\infty \). In these conditions the asymptotic behaviour of \(f\left( z\right) \) can be described by a result of Hille (Lectures on Ordinary Differential Equations in the complex plane, Addison Wesley, Boston, 1969) on ordinary differential equations in the complex plane. The results obtained are framed in the value distribution theory of meromorphic functions, in particular in the punctured plane we shall consider the work of Khrystiyanin and Kondratyuk (Mat Stud 23(1):19–30, 2005; Mat Stud 23(1):57–68, 2005) and Korhonen (Nevanlinna theory on an annulus. Value distribution theory and related topics. Adv. Complex analysis and applications, Kluwer Academic Publishers, Dordrecht, 2004). 相似文献

Franco Cataldo Pietro Ragni Susana Iglesias-Groth Arturo Manchado 《Journal of Radioanalytical and Nuclear Chemistry》2011,287(2):573-580
The sulphur-containing proteinaceous amino acids l-cysteine, l-cystine and l-methionine were irradiated in the solid state to a dose of 3.2 MGy. This dose corresponds to that delivered by radionuclide
decay in a timescale of 1.05 × 109 years to the organic matter buried at a depth >20 m in comets and asteroids. The purity of the sulphur-containing amino acids
was studied by differential scanning calorimetry (DSC) before and after the solid state radiolysis and the preservation of
the chirality after the radiolysis was studied by chirooptical methods (optical rotatory dispersion, ORD) and by FT-IR spectroscopy.
Although the high radiation dose of 3.2 MGy delivered, all the amino acids studied show a high radiation resistance. The best
radiation resistance was offered by l-cysteine. The radiolysis of l-cysteine leads to the formation of l-cystine. The radiation resistance of l-methionine is not at the level of l-cysteine but also l-methionine is able to survive the dose of 3.2 MGy. Furthermore in all cases examined the preservation of chirality after
radiolysis was clearly observed by the ORD spectroscopy although a certain level of radioracemization was measured in all
cases. The radioracemization is minimal in the case of l-cysteine and is more pronounced in the case of l-methionine. In conclusion, the study shows that the sulphur-containing amino acids can survive for 1.05 × 109 years and, after extrapolation of the data, even to the age of the Solar System i.e. to 4.6 × 109 years. 相似文献

Arturo González-Hernández 《Journal of organometallic chemistry》2011,696(21):3436-3439
The reaction between the dihydride of decacarbonyltriosmium [H2Os3(CO)10] and phenyl arsine oxide (PAO) in benzene yields only one product [Os3(O)9(μ-H){μ-PhAs(O)OAsPh}] (1), which is characterized by high resolution mass spectrometry (HRMS), Fast Atomic Bombardment Mass Spectrometry (FAB)+, IR, 1H and 13C NMR, and single crystal X-ray diffraction. The solid state X-ray diffraction study of compound (1) shows that the molecule is polycyclic and has an osmium triangle with a bridging hydride bonded to a PhAs(O)-O-AsPh ligand. 相似文献
